Common Window Blinds Cleaning Jobs
Vertical Blinds - cleaning removes dust and dirt buildup for a fresh appearance.
Roman and Drapery Shades - gentle washing restores fabric brightness and removes stains.
Wood and Faux Wood Blinds - dusting and wiping maintain their natural finish and prevent damage.
Aluminum and Mini Blinds - thorough cleaning reduces allergens and improves overall look.
Motorized and Cellular Shades - safe cleaning techniques help preserve their functionality and lifespan.
Specialty Window Coverings - professional cleaning extends the life and maintains their aesthetic appeal.
Window Blinds Cleaning Questions
What types of window blinds can be cleaned? Various types including vertical, horizontal, fabric, and wooden blinds can be cleaned to improve appearance and functionality.
How often should window blinds be cleaned? Regular cleaning is recommended every few months to prevent dust buildup and maintain their condition.
Are there specific cleaning methods for different blind materials? Yes, different materials may require dusting, vacuuming, or gentle wiping to avoid damage.
What are common issues addressed during blind cleaning? Dust, dirt, stains, and residue are typically removed to restore blinds to a cleaner state.
